Windows视频播放质量提升:MPC Video Renderer完全指南
【免费下载链接】VideoRendererВнешний видео-рендерер项目地址: https://gitcode.com/gh_mirrors/vi/VideoRenderer
你是否曾经在播放高清视频时遇到画面卡顿、色彩失真或者系统资源占用过高的问题?这些困扰不仅影响观影体验,更让人对电脑性能产生怀疑。今天,我们将深入介绍一款能够彻底解决这些问题的专业工具——MPC Video Renderer。
视频播放优化的技术挑战
在探索解决方案之前,我们需要了解传统视频播放面临的几大技术瓶颈:
计算资源限制:软件渲染器依赖CPU处理视频数据,4K分辨率下CPU占用率急剧上升色彩还原精度:普通渲染器无法正确处理HDR内容,导致画面细节丢失硬件兼容性:不同显卡和驱动对视频处理的支持程度不一系统稳定性:高负载播放时容易出现画面撕裂和音频不同步
MPC Video Renderer的核心技术优势
MPC Video Renderer是一款专为DirectShow框架设计的视频渲染器,通过深度硬件加速技术,将视频处理任务从CPU转移到GPU,实现真正的性能突破。
关键技术特性:
- 硬件加速渲染:利用GPU并行计算能力,大幅降低CPU负载
- 完整HDR支持:原生支持HDR10、HLG等主流HDR格式
- 智能色彩管理:确保画面色彩准确还原,支持广色域显示
- 高效内存管理:优化视频内存使用,提升系统整体性能
快速部署:从源码到运行
获取项目代码
要开始使用MPC Video Renderer,首先需要获取项目源代码:
git clone https://gitcode.com/gh_mirrors/vi/VideoRenderer编译环境配置
项目采用Visual Studio解决方案,使用根目录下的MpcVideoRenderer.sln文件即可打开完整项目。
关键配置参数
在配置MPC Video Renderer时,以下几个设置对性能影响最大:
渲染路径选择:根据硬件支持情况选择D3D11或D3D9渲染器视频处理器模式:启用DXVA2或D3D11视频处理器以获得最佳效果HDR转换设置:根据显示设备特性调整HDR到SDR的转换参数
性能表现对比分析
通过实际测试数据,我们可以清晰地看到MPC Video Renderer的性能优势:
CPU使用率对比:播放4K HDR内容时,传统渲染器CPU占用60-80%,而MPC Video Renderer仅需15-25%画面流畅度:高动态场景下保持稳定帧率,有效避免画面撕裂色彩保真度:HDR内容播放时色彩过渡自然,暗部细节保留完整
实际应用场景深度解析
家庭娱乐中心
在连接大屏幕电视的HTPC上,MPC Video Renderer能够充分发挥显示设备潜力,提供影院级观影体验。
专业视频制作
对于视频质量评估和色彩管理工作,准确的色彩还原和细节表现至关重要。
老旧硬件优化
即使在性能有限的设备上,通过硬件加速也能实现流畅的高清视频播放。
高级功能定制指南
着色器系统详解
项目提供了丰富的着色器资源,位于Shaders目录下,支持深度定制:
- 色彩空间转换:Shaders/convert/
- D3D11渲染路径:Shaders/d3d11/
- 帧重缩放算法:Shaders/resize/
字幕渲染系统
MPC Video Renderer内置先进字幕渲染引擎,支持多种字幕格式,智能处理字幕与视频融合。
常见技术问题解决方案
安装识别问题:确保正确注册渲染器组件,可使用项目中的注册脚本HDR显示异常:检查HDR转SDR设置,确认显示设备支持HDR模式特定格式兼容:尝试切换不同视频处理器模式,或更新显卡驱动程序
总结:选择MPC Video Renderer的理由
MPC Video Renderer不仅仅是一个视频渲染组件,它是完整的视频播放优化体系。通过硬件加速、专业级色彩管理和先进视频处理技术,它能够将你的视频播放体验提升到全新高度。
无论你是普通视频爱好者还是专业用户,MPC Video Renderer都能带来显著的性能改进。现在就开始体验专业级的视频播放效果吧!
【免费下载链接】VideoRendererВнешний видео-рендерер项目地址: https://gitcode.com/gh_mirrors/vi/VideoRenderer
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考